摘要:
軟件開發(fā)的軟件系統(tǒng)設(shè)計(jì)環(huán)節(jié)是整個(gè)軟件開發(fā)過(guò)程中至關(guān)重要的一環(huán)。本文將從需求分析、統(tǒng)設(shè)統(tǒng)設(shè)架構(gòu)設(shè)計(jì)、計(jì)環(huán)節(jié)系計(jì)游鍵詞模塊設(shè)計(jì)和接口設(shè)計(jì)四個(gè)方面進(jìn)行詳細(xì)闡述,戲開并對(duì)每個(gè)方面分別進(jìn)行自然段的發(fā)關(guān)論述,以便讀者深入了解系統(tǒng)設(shè)計(jì)環(huán)節(jié)的實(shí)踐重要性。
一、軟件需求分析
1、統(tǒng)設(shè)統(tǒng)設(shè)需求分析的計(jì)環(huán)節(jié)系計(jì)游鍵詞意義
2、需求分析的戲開步驟
3、需求分析的發(fā)關(guān)工具和技術(shù)
二、架構(gòu)設(shè)計(jì)
1、實(shí)踐架構(gòu)設(shè)計(jì)的軟件定義
2、常用的統(tǒng)設(shè)統(tǒng)設(shè)架構(gòu)風(fēng)格
3、架構(gòu)設(shè)計(jì)的計(jì)環(huán)節(jié)系計(jì)游鍵詞原則和方法
三、模塊設(shè)計(jì)
1、模塊設(shè)計(jì)的目的
2、模塊設(shè)計(jì)的基本原則
3、模塊設(shè)計(jì)的實(shí)踐技巧
四、接口設(shè)計(jì)
1、接口設(shè)計(jì)的概念
2、接口設(shè)計(jì)的重要性
3、接口設(shè)計(jì)的指導(dǎo)原則
五、總結(jié):
系統(tǒng)設(shè)計(jì)環(huán)節(jié)是軟件開發(fā)中不可或缺的一部分,通過(guò)需求分析、架構(gòu)設(shè)計(jì)、模塊設(shè)計(jì)和接口設(shè)計(jì)四個(gè)方面的詳細(xì)闡述,本文對(duì)系統(tǒng)設(shè)計(jì)的重要性進(jìn)行了深入的探討。在軟件開發(fā)過(guò)程中,系統(tǒng)設(shè)計(jì)環(huán)節(jié)的合理規(guī)劃和操作對(duì)確保軟件質(zhì)量和項(xiàng)目成功具有重要意義。
在需求分析方面,正確的需求分析可以有效地理解用戶需求,并將其轉(zhuǎn)化為軟件系統(tǒng)的功能和性能要求。通過(guò)合適的需求分析步驟和工具,可以確保軟件開發(fā)始終與用戶需求保持一致。
在架構(gòu)設(shè)計(jì)方面,良好的架構(gòu)設(shè)計(jì)可以提供可靠的系統(tǒng)結(jié)構(gòu),并確保系統(tǒng)功能的完整性和可擴(kuò)展性。通過(guò)選擇合適的架構(gòu)風(fēng)格和應(yīng)用設(shè)計(jì)原則,可以確保系統(tǒng)具備良好的模塊化和可維護(hù)性。
在模塊設(shè)計(jì)方面,合理的模塊設(shè)計(jì)可以將系統(tǒng)按照功能和責(zé)任進(jìn)行劃分,提高系統(tǒng)的組織性和可重用性。通過(guò)遵循模塊設(shè)計(jì)的基本原則和實(shí)踐技巧,可以確保模塊之間的協(xié)作和通信無(wú)縫銜接。
在接口設(shè)計(jì)方面,清晰而合理的接口設(shè)計(jì)可以確保不同模塊之間的通信和數(shù)據(jù)交換的準(zhǔn)確性和有效性。通過(guò)制定明確的接口設(shè)計(jì)指導(dǎo)原則,可以避免不必要的溝通成本和錯(cuò)誤。
綜上所述,軟件開發(fā)的系統(tǒng)設(shè)計(jì)環(huán)節(jié)是確保軟件質(zhì)量和項(xiàng)目成功的重要環(huán)節(jié)。通過(guò)正確的需求分析、架構(gòu)設(shè)計(jì)、模塊設(shè)計(jì)和接口設(shè)計(jì),可以確保系統(tǒng)具備良好的功能、性能和可擴(kuò)展性,同時(shí)提高軟件開發(fā)團(tuán)隊(duì)的協(xié)同工作效率和項(xiàng)目交付質(zhì)量。未來(lái)的研究方向可以進(jìn)一步探索自動(dòng)化設(shè)計(jì)工具和方法,以提高系統(tǒng)設(shè)計(jì)的效率和準(zhǔn)確性。